The VIA Rail Canada Police Service (VRCPS) (French: Service de police de VIA Rail Canada (SPVRC)) is the federal railway police service of the Canadian intercity passenger rail operator, VIA Rail Canada Inc.
The agency was formed in 2015 under the Railway Safety Act with Peter Lambrinakos becoming VIA Rail Canada’s first chief of police and chief of corporate security.[1] As a railway police service, the agency is under the purview of the Department of Transport Canada.
